When evaluating long-running commands in patat, the slide remains unresponsive until the command is finished. This can be an issue when giving presentations as it can interrupt the flow of the talk. It would be helpful to have a way to display the output of the command in real-time, so the audience can see progress as it is made.
This is particularly important for commands that write log lines to stdout every few seconds, as it would be useful to see those lines as they are received by patat.
A desirable addition to the patat eval configuration would be the inclusion of a timeout parameter.
